YearAnnual SalaryStatus
2019$90,319Actual
2020$93,905Actual
2021$94,964Actual
2022$97,699Actual
2023$112,685Actual
2024$114,143Actual
2025$123,093Actual
2026(current)$129,937Estimated
2027$137,161Projected

Based on 7 years of BLS OEWS data for the Harlingen metropolitan area, the median veterinarian salary grew 36.3% from $90,319 (2019) to $123,093 (2025). At a 5.56% compound annual growth rate, salaries are projected to reach $137,161 by 2027 — a total increase of $46,842 (51.86%) from 2019.

Veterinarian Job Market in Harlingen

The local job market for veterinarians in Harlingen currently employs 14 professionals, revealing thoughtful competition in this relatively small pool. Despite the slightly lower salary levels, the cost of living may afford a comfortable lifestyle, reflecting on take-home purchasing power. Practices affiliated with corporate entities, such as VCA and BluePearl, which constitute about 25% of the market, often offer higher pay compared to smaller independent clinics. The spread in pay can also be attributed to several factors, including specialization—board-certified veterinarians in surgery or internal medicine earn considerably more than general practitioners. Furthermore, opportunities for production-based compensation and the potential for sign-on bonuses, especially for new graduates in underserved areas, may significantly enhance overall earnings.
